Specifications
Engine & Performance
- Power
- 174 hp
- Torque
- 250 Nm
- Transmission
- AUTOMATIC
- Fuel Type
- electric
Dimensions
- Length × Width × Height
- 4545 × 1890 × 1635 mm
- Wheelbase
- 2840 mm
- Ground Clearance
- 190 mm
- Kerb Weight
- 2,085 kg
Fuel Efficiency
The Vinfast VF 7 is fully electric. Zero fuel costs for expressway commuting. Approximate electricity cost: ₱1.50/km vs ₱4-5/km for gasoline vehicles.
